What Is EPA and Why Does Your Body Like It?
EPA stands for eicosapentaenoic acid, one of the main omega-3 fats that your body uses to stay balanced. It's known most for helping your body manage inflammation. That sounds like a small job, but inflammation is tied to how your joints move, how your heart pumps, and how your whole system handles stress.
EPA works alongside another omega-3 called DHA. While DHA helps your brain and eyes, EPA is more about daily energy, joint flexibility, and overall wellness. Together, they keep the body grounded in a calm and steady rhythm.
But here’s the catch. Your body doesn’t make EPA on its own. You need to get it through what you eat or through supplements. And if you don’t eat much fish—or you’re plant-based—there’s a chance your EPA intake could be pretty low.

Why the Source of Your Omega Matters?
Not all omega-3s are the same. A lot of plant-based options, like chia or flax, give you ALA. That’s a type of omega-3 your body has to try to change into EPA or DHA. But our bodies aren’t very efficient at making that switch. So even if you’re eating a lot of ALA, you still may not be getting the support your body needs.
EPA supplements that come from algae are already in the right form, so your body can use them right away. That’s a key difference. Algae-based EPA is clean, effective, and doesn’t carry the common concerns some people have with fish oil, like a strong aftertaste or digestive discomfort.
